The contact owns a 2019 Ford F-350. The contact stated while driving at an undisclosed speed, the contact noticed that the windshield wipers became inoperable. The contact stated that when the windshield wipers were engaged, the contact could not shut off the windshield wipers. The contact had to turn off the vehicle to stop the windshield wipers. The contact restarted the vehicle, and the failure persisted. The contact also stated that the exterior lights were inoperable. The contact stated that the exterior lights were turning off and on while driving. The dealer was contacted. The vehicle was not diagnosed or repaired. The manufacturer was notified of the failure. The approximate failure mileage was 74,000.

Our company has had multiple vehicle failures of the shutter door which prevents the vehicle from defrosting causing dangerous low visibly through the windshield. Specifically 3 - F350's and 2 - F550's all of which are model years 2019 and 2020. They have been replaced under warranty and continue to fail at an alarming rate.

Windshield wipers continue to operate in slowest intermittent mode when switched to the off position. This also causes the headlights to be illuminated. This happens at all speeds from a full stop to highway speeds. This appears to be a widespread problem with wiper switches amongst F-350 pick up trucks in Florida or hotter climates. Part cost is $75 dollars plus tax and 1 hour of labor $130. This causes driver distraction and crash potential.
